The Strict Order of Delirium was declared in 1998 and has evolved to it's present form through numerous major transformations concerning line-up and style. De Lirium's Order, playing and stating their unique form of bloodstained art, is one of the most versatile bands in the Finnish Neo-Death/Thrash scene. When it comes to grinding blastbeats combined with technical arragements, catchy thrash-lines, obscure melodies, guitar solos or whatever it may be, DLO sounds like nothing but a chainsaw singing in the night. The first demo-cd "Termination in Surreal" was caught on tape in notorious Perkele-studio, Kuopio, Finland. The contents were far too mixed and confusing so the demo can be considered as an experiment. Then came the demo of success, "Morbid Brains", which was recorded by S.M. NekroC himself in his own Midgard Studio. The release led to record contract with Woodcut Records in Summer '03. The main composer S.M. NekroC had luckily much of new material ready and Tico Tico -studio in Kemi, Finland was reserved. DLO recorded the debut album "Victim no. 52", which gives us a glance to the world of the cold-blooded, morbid minds behind their morbid acts. Now the manners of Mr. de Lirium are more lethal than ever. A lot of progress has happened since the days of "Victim no. 52".
